Stocks end session higher with Dow stocks leading the way

Rating:

12345
Loading...

The Dow industrial average is closing higher by 108 points or 0.44% at 24748.73. That index led the way in what was an up and down session

Below are the closing levels for the major indices:
Dow industrial average +108 points or +0.44% at 24,748.73. The high reached 24,750.73 while the low extended to 24,416.03
The S&P index closed up 8.66 points or 0.32% at 2682.11. The high reached 2682.53, while the low extended to 2655.89
The Nasdaq index closed near unchanged levels at 7082.69. It's high reached 7105.14 while the low extended to 7014.36.
The S&P index closed above the end of your closing level at 2673.61. So the index is back in the black for the year.

The Dow also moved back into positive territory for the year. It closed 2017 at 24,719.22.

The Nasdaq fell below its 2017 closing level last week at 6,903.38 for one day, but has been above the level since then.
